If you have time development is free on your watch but really the sheer size of an R200 would suffice with 6000 series alum just use
many fins for strength and cooling, through bolts and smaller sump
like on the alfa one in the pics.
Lsd options are getting limited and Id pay well for a billet casing
as attaining R200 lsds is easy and cheap compared to H series LSDs.

If you think the subey market is worthwhile go for it the long nose r180 is what you can do but will need reinforcing fins and ribs, larger billet piece to start with as there arent any short nose ones I know of, while the late r200 are all short nose.
The R180 long nose is a nice diff and easier to fit over the r200 and will suit 240 260z enthusiasts also which is a decent market.

Dont try and make a case for both just do a nicely finned r180 then youll have subey, Z, 1600, 180 and 200SSS and even perhaps miata and other kit car builders after them as atm there is nothing to replace the all alloy sierra 7.5 inch IRS diffs which where all dried out from the sierra cosworths in the 80s and used in every lightweight car project and racer for the last 30 years.

Go for it R180 it is!
